How to get my vitale carte as an international student after submitting docs?

Hello, I had submitted my documents on https://etudiant-etranger.ameli.fr/espace/#/student-area four months ago. Some of them are still not approved, I have a temporary certificate with a SS number, but I am not sure if that provides me with proper health insurance. Please let me know how I can access my Vitale carte. I tried logging in, but I don't have a 4 digit code, and I tried contacting but I only speak basic French, so I didn't understand the message on the call. If the temporary one works, then what is the process to register myself with a GP and claim reimbursement?

Hello KJ,

If your social security number starts by 7 or 8, it means that it's a temporary social security number. You can't creat your ameli account and access your Vitale card. 
You can open an ameli account and obtain the Vitale card only  with a permanent social security number (starting by 1 or 2).

Unfortunately, because of safety and confidentiality issues, we can’t reach any of your information or file from this forum.

The processing times vary depending on the type of files and the number of files being processed by your caisse primaire d'assurance maladie (CPAM).

If you need help regarding this request, you can contact the CPAM’s English or French Advice Lines.

Hi, so even if I can't get my card, do I still get the refunds? if yes, how? and is there is a big difference between the services of the card and just the temp SS number?

Even with a temporary social security number, you've got the same rights and you can get your refunds. You will have to send your claim form (feuille de soins) filed with your information (social security number, name ...) to your local CPAM's office.

The processing times vary depending on the type of files and the number of files being processed by your caisse primaire d'assurance maladie (CPAM).

To obtain better reimbursement, I recommend you to consult. Once you have chosen your referring doctor, you will need to inform your local health insurance fund (CPAM) about it.
The process can be completed online if the doctor you have chosen as your referring doctor offers to do so and you agree and if you have a carte Vitale. Practically speaking, during an appointment at his/her practice, you can give the doctor your “carte Vitale” insurance card and the doctor will make the report online and submit it electronically to your local health insurance fund (CPAM).
Otherwise, you and the doctor can fill in and sign the “Declaring a referring doctor” form (“Déclaration de choix du médecin traitant (PDF)” S3704b) together and submit it to your local health insurance fund, or send it by post.
